Upcoming iOS 14.5 update includes Face Unlock with mask on, gaming control support and 5G connection in dual SIM mode

iossss-crop.jpg

With the recent iOS 14.3 update, the 14.5 beta version is currently underway. Most of the time, iOS versions have a few exciting things to look forward to but 14.5 says otherwise. From the sources, the new update may come with a Face Unlock while wearing a mask, adding gaming controller support and enabling 5G connectivity in dual SIM mode.

Starting with the Face Unlock, Apple is integrating a new way to unlock your iPhone without taking your mask off. However, you would need the Apple Watch as it serves as an extra layer of security. So how this works is the iPhone would do a partial face scan together with the Apple Watch, notifying you that the unlocking is successful.

The other update is adding support for gaming pads, namely the PlayStation 5 DualSense and Xbox Series X controllers. Besides the iPhone, the iPadOS and tvOS next update are included and this is a sweet way for Apple Arcade or iOS mobile gamers to take control. Last but not least, 5G dual-SIM mode (the nano-SIM and eSIM) on the iPhone 12 series are currently in testing and it will be available globally.
